How to Import Files from a Computer to Android
Most people use their LG K61 devices for personal use, but there are plenty of business applications for them as well. If you’re one of the many people who need to transfer files from a computer to an Android device, there are a few different ways to do it.
The easiest way to move files from a PC to an LG K61 device is by using a USB cable. Simply connect your Android device to your computer using a USB cable, then open the file explorer on your PC and locate the files you want to transfer. Once you’ve found the files you want to move, just drag and drop them into the appropriate folder on your LG K61 device.
If you don’t have a USB cable handy, or if you’re trying to move a large number of files, you can use a cloud-based storage service like Dropbox or Google Drive. To use either of these services, simply create an account and install the app on both your computer and your Android device. Once you’ve done that, you can upload files from your computer to your cloud account, then download them onto your LG K61 device.
Another option for moving files from a PC to an Android device is by using an SD card. If your computer has an SD card slot, you can insert an SD card into it, then copy the files you want to transfer onto the card. Once the files are on the SD card, you can remove it from your computer and insert it into your LG K61 device. The files will then be available for use on your Android device.
